About Converting Centigrams per Tablespoon to Centigrams per Cup

Centigram per Tablespoon and Centigram per Cup both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

centigrams per cup = centigrams per tablespoon × 16

This factor comes from each unit's defined relationship to the category's base unit: 1 centigram per tablespoon equals 0.676280454037 base units, and 1 centigram per cup equals 0.0422675283773 base units, so dividing one by the other gives the direct centigram per tablespoon-to-centigram per cup factor of 16.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
